In 2025, global sales of low-emissivity (LEE) coated glass reached 360 million square meters, with an average selling price of US$14.8 per square meter. LLE coating glass refers to glass with multiple layers of metal or metal oxide films deposited on the surface of float glass using magnetron sputtering or in-line chemical vapor deposition. This allows it to maintain high visible light transmittance while exhibiting high reflectivity for far-infrared thermal radiation, significantly reducing the heat transfer coefficient of buildings or transportation vehicles. It is a key functional glass for achieving energy-efficient buildings and green curtain walls. Its upstream raw materials mainly include ultra-clear float glass substrates, silver sputtering targets, zinc oxide, titanium dioxide, argon gas and other sputtering consumables, as well as electricity and equipment. Typical material consumption is approximately 0.8-1.2 kg of silver per 10,000 square meters of glass, with the cost of sputtering targets and auxiliary materials accounting for 30%-35% of the manufacturing cost. Downstream applications mainly include insulated glass factories for building doors, windows, and curtain walls, passive houses, commercial complexes, and automotive sunroofs and side windows. Building energy conservation accounts for approximately 70% of downstream consumption, automobiles and rail transit approximately 20%, and home appliances and others approximately 10%. In terms of production capacity, the global total capacity of Low-E coating lines is approximately 550 million square meters per year, with an overall capacity utilization rate of about 65%-75%; the industry average gross profit margin is about 25%-35%. The future lies in upgrading towards high-transparency triple and quadruple silver coatings, multi-functional composite coatings, temperability and flexibility, and integration with vacuum glass and building-integrated photovoltaics (BIPV). Regarding demand and business opportunities, increasingly stringent global building energy efficiency regulations, renovation of old buildings, and urbanization in emerging markets will continue to drive demand. Meanwhile, lightweighting and improved comfort in automobiles also bring incremental growth potential. Coupled with domestic substitution of high-end products and intelligent transformation of production lines, low-emissivity coated glass still possesses stable market growth opportunities and medium- to long-term investment value.


The low-emissivity (LEE) coated glass market has shown steady growth in recent years, primarily driven by global building energy efficiency policies, green building demand, and the construction of high-end residential and commercial complexes. Regionally, North America and Europe have relatively stable demand for Low-E glass due to improved energy efficiency regulations, with a preference for high-performance triple-silver and quadruple-silver products. In the Asia-Pacific region, especially China, India, and Southeast Asia, new construction and renovation projects are driving rapid demand growth, indicating a broad market potential. By application area, building doors and windows and curtain walls dominate, accounting for approximately 65%-70% of the market share. Demand for automotive and rail transit sunroofs and side windows is gradually increasing, accounting for about 20%, while applications in home appliances and other smart devices account for about 10%-15%.


From a competitive landscape perspective, the industry exhibits a segment-to-central structure: upstream raw materials are highly concentrated in a few glass manufacturers and sputtering target suppliers; midstream coating production lines are mainly controlled by large glass companies and specialized Low-E manufacturers; and downstream demand is fragmented, with customers primarily being construction, automotive, and home appliance manufacturers. Overall, the low-emissivity coated glass market is characterized by high technological barriers, large capital investment, and significant economies of scale. Leading companies can gain a competitive advantage through intelligent production lines, R&D of functional glass, and the development of high-end products.


In the future, with the upgrading of energy-efficient building regulations, the popularization of high-performance products, and the increasing demand for lightweighting in new energy vehicles, the Low-E glass market will continue to maintain medium-to-high-speed growth, bringing technological innovation and investment opportunities.
